Output ba7615d29fc6a197cff374a1d760baeabdf1c02c912682301cbd27da3c68a8af:0

value
429178
script pubkey
OP_0 OP_PUSHBYTES_20 5df5573631810937329eb38e3096ace9b2d03648
address
bc1qth64wd33syynwv57kw8rp94vaxedqdjgtjefuh
transaction
ba7615d29fc6a197cff374a1d760baeabdf1c02c912682301cbd27da3c68a8af
confirmations
159225
spent
true